Own Your Shift isn’t about fixing yourself.
It’s about understanding how you learned to be the way you are—and what happens when you stop assuming those patterns are permanent.
A lot of what we experience doesn’t start with us. It’s inherited. Learned. Conditioned. Wired into the nervous system long before we had language for it. And while awareness matters, awareness alone doesn’t always create change.
Here, we talk about what happens after awareness.
We explore:
How stress patterns get passed down through families
Why your body reacts even when your mind “knows better”
The intersection of neuroscience, nervous system regulation, and energy
How real change happens in real time—not by reliving the past, but by creating from the present
This isn’t a podcast about talking in circles or endlessly unpacking stories.
It’s about ownership. Embodiment. And learning how to live differently once you see what’s actually been running the show.
